    Verdict

    The DJI Phantom 4 Advanced is a high-performance quadcopter featuring a 1-inch 20MP CMOS sensor capable of recording 4K video at 60fps with a 100Mbps bitrate and a mechanical shutter to eliminate rolling shutter distortion. Built with a titanium and magnesium alloy body for reduced weight, it offers a top speed of 45 mph (72 km/h) in Sport Mode and a maximum flight time of approximately 30 minutes. Main pros include its professional-grade camera quality, 4.3-mile (7km) transmission range, and dual-redundancy sensors (IMU and compass) for stable flight. However, cons include its lack of side and rear obstacle sensors compared to the Pro model, restriction to the 2.4GHz frequency band which is more prone to interference, and a relatively loud operating noise.

    What customers like about DJI Phantom 4 Advanced?

    • High-quality 20MP 1-inch CMOS sensor for excellent image detail and dynamic range
    • Smooth 4K video recording at up to 60fps with a 100Mbps bitrate
    • Mechanical shutter that effectively eliminates rolling shutter distortion
    • Reliable flight stability even in moderate wind conditions
    • Extended flight time of up to 30 minutes per battery charge
    • Impressive 4.3-mile (7km) transmission range using Lightbridge technology
    • Advanced autonomous flight modes including ActiveTrack and TapFly
    • Sturdy construction with a lightweight magnesium alloy unibody

    What customers dislike about DJI Phantom 4 Advanced?

    • Lacks the side and rear-facing obstacle sensors found on the Pro model
    • Considered bulky and less portable as the landing gear and arms do not fold
    • Spare batteries are notably expensive
    • No longer officially supported or serviced by DJI as of mid-2025
    • Some users report connection issues between the smartphone app and the remote
    • Remote controller only supports the 2.4GHz frequency band (no 5.8GHz support)
    • Propellers can occasionally appear in the frame when flying at high speeds in Sport mode
